  1. from homeassistant.components.fan import (
  2. DIRECTION_FORWARD,
  3. DIRECTION_REVERSE,
  4. SUPPORT_DIRECTION,
  5. SUPPORT_PRESET_MODE,
  6. SUPPORT_SET_SPEED,
  7. )
  8. from ..const import ARLEC_FAN_PAYLOAD
  9. from ..helpers import assert_device_properties_set
  10. from ..mixins.select import BasicSelectTests
  11. from ..mixins.switch import SwitchableTests
  12. from .base_device_tests import TuyaDeviceTestCase
  13. SWITCH_DPS = "1"
  14. SPEED_DPS = "3"
  15. DIRECTION_DPS = "4"
  16. PRESET_DPS = "102"
  17. TIMER_DPS = "103"
  18. class TestArlecFan(SwitchableTests, BasicSelectTests, TuyaDeviceTestCase):
  19. __test__ = True
  20. def setUp(self):
  21. self.setUpForConfig("arlec_fan.yaml", ARLEC_FAN_PAYLOAD)
  22. self.subject = self.entities["fan"]
  23. self.timer = self.entities["select_timer"]
  24. self.setUpSwitchable(SWITCH_DPS, self.subject)
  25. self.setUpBasicSelect(
  26. TIMER_DPS,
  27. self.entities["select_timer"],
  28. {
  29. "off": "Off",
  30. "2hour": "2 hours",
  31. "4hour": "4 hours",
  32. "8hour": "8 hours",
  33. },
  34. )
  35. self.mark_secondary(["select_timer"])
  36. def test_supported_features(self):
  37. self.assertEqual(
  38. self.subject.supported_features,
  39. SUPPORT_DIRECTION | SUPPORT_PRESET_MODE | SUPPORT_SET_SPEED,
  40. )
  41. def test_preset_mode(self):
  42. self.dps[PRESET_DPS] = "normal"
  43. self.assertEqual(self.subject.preset_mode, "normal")
  44. self.dps[PRESET_DPS] = "breeze"
  45. self.assertEqual(self.subject.preset_mode, "breeze")
  46. self.dps[PRESET_DPS] = "sleep"
  47. self.assertEqual(self.subject.preset_mode, "sleep")
  48. self.dps[PRESET_DPS] = None
  49. self.assertIs(self.subject.preset_mode, None)
  50. def test_preset_modes(self):
  51. self.assertCountEqual(self.subject.preset_modes, ["normal", "breeze", "sleep"])
  52. async def test_set_preset_mode_to_normal(self):
  53. async with assert_device_properties_set(
  54. self.subject._device,
  55. {PRESET_DPS: "normal"},
  56. ):
  57. await self.subject.async_set_preset_mode("normal")
  58. async def test_set_preset_mode_to_breeze(self):
  59. async with assert_device_properties_set(
  60. self.subject._device,
  61. {PRESET_DPS: "breeze"},
  62. ):
  63. await self.subject.async_set_preset_mode("breeze")
  64. async def test_set_preset_mode_to_sleep(self):
  65. async with assert_device_properties_set(
  66. self.subject._device,
  67. {PRESET_DPS: "sleep"},
  68. ):
  69. await self.subject.async_set_preset_mode("sleep")
  70. def test_direction(self):
  71. self.dps[DIRECTION_DPS] = "forward"
  72. self.assertEqual(self.subject.current_direction, DIRECTION_FORWARD)
  73. self.dps[DIRECTION_DPS] = "reverse"
  74. self.assertEqual(self.subject.current_direction, DIRECTION_REVERSE)
  75. async def test_set_direction_forward(self):
  76. async with assert_device_properties_set(
  77. self.subject._device, {DIRECTION_DPS: "forward"}
  78. ):
  79. await self.subject.async_set_direction(DIRECTION_FORWARD)
  80. async def test_set_direction_reverse(self):
  81. async with assert_device_properties_set(
  82. self.subject._device, {DIRECTION_DPS: "reverse"}
  83. ):
  84. await self.subject.async_set_direction(DIRECTION_REVERSE)
  85. def test_speed(self):
  86. self.dps[SPEED_DPS] = "3"
  87. self.assertEqual(self.subject.percentage, 50)
  88. def test_speed_step(self):
  89. self.assertAlmostEqual(self.subject.percentage_step, 16.67, 2)
  90. self.assertEqual(self.subject.speed_count, 6)
  91. async def test_set_speed(self):
  92. async with assert_device_properties_set(self.subject._device, {SPEED_DPS: 2}):
  93. await self.subject.async_set_percentage(33)
  94. async def test_set_speed_in_normal_mode_snaps(self):
  95. self.dps[PRESET_DPS] = "normal"
  96. async with assert_device_properties_set(self.subject._device, {SPEED_DPS: 5}):
  97. await self.subject.async_set_percentage(80)
  98. def test_extra_state_attributes(self):
  99. self.dps[TIMER_DPS] = "2hour"
  100. self.assertEqual(self.subject.extra_state_attributes, {"timer": "2hour"})
